Remission Induction Therapy with Rituximab for Microscopic Polyangiitis: A Feasibility Study.
Ayako Saito1, Yoichi Takeuchi1, Saeko Kagaya1
1Department of Nephrology, Japanese Red Cross Ishinomaki Hospital.
The Tohoku Journal of Experimental Medicine
|May 26, 2017
Summary
A single dose of rituximab (RTX) effectively induced remission in microscopic polyangiitis (MPA) patients in Japan, allowing for reduced prednisolone use and fewer complications. This approach shows promise for MPA induction therapy.

Background:
- Anti-neutrophil cytoplasmic antibody (ANCA)-associated vasculitis (AAV) encompasses systemic vascular inflammation, with microscopic polyangiitis (MPA) being a prevalent subtype in Japan.
- MPA commonly impacts the kidneys and lungs, posing a significant mortality risk if left untreated.
- Current induction therapy for MPA, often involving methylprednisolone and cyclophosphamide, requires optimization, and the role of rituximab (RTX) in MPA treatment, particularly dosing, remains debated.
Observation:
- This retrospective study evaluated six newly diagnosed MPA patients in Japan treated with methylprednisolone and a single 375 mg/m² dose of RTX.
- Clinical features, efficacy, and safety of this RTX regimen were assessed.
- The study focused on the effectiveness of a single RTX dose, a regimen not extensively studied in Japan for MPA.
Findings:
- All six patients achieved remission within 12 months, with a tapered prednisolone dose below 10 mg/day.
- One patient experienced relapse after 12 months, and another was hospitalized for infective spondyloarthritis.
- No adverse reactions to RTX infusion or late-onset neutropenia were observed, indicating a favorable safety profile.
Implications:
- A single RTX dose demonstrates potential as an effective induction therapy for MPA, facilitating prednisolone dose reduction.
- This regimen offers a promising, potentially cost-effective alternative to multi-dose RTX protocols.
- Further investigation into single-dose RTX for MPA induction therapy is warranted, especially in the Japanese population.
